App store submission requires gathering version information, rewriting release notes for each platform, and manually uploading builds and metadata to multiple app stores. Manual tracking and daily status checks create delays and inconsistencies across iOS, Android, and web releases.
Automation reads release data from source control, generates platform-specific release notes respecting each store's requirements, submits builds and metadata via store APIs, and monitors approval status in real time.
The full workflow, from trigger to completion.
Automation is triggered when a new release tag is pushed to the repository. The tag name and commit metadata are captured automatically.
The automation reads the commit log, changelog file, and version number from the repository. Release notes are parsed and structured for processing.
The automation adapts the release notes for iOS App Store, Google Play, and web platforms, respecting character limits and formatting rules for each. the automation produces three versions ready for submission.
A new row is added to the release tracking sheet with version number, release date, platform details, and submission status. This becomes the single source of truth.
An email is sent to the release manager with the generated release notes, asset requirements, and a link to the tracking sheet. The manager reviews and approves before store submission.
Release manager reviews the generated notes, uploads final screenshots and metadata to a shared folder, and confirms readiness. This human gate ensures quality before store submission.
The automation uses store APIs to submit the app build, release notes, and metadata to iOS App Store Connect and Google Play Console. Both submissions are logged with timestamps.
The automation polls App Store Connect and Google Play Console every 4 hours for approval status. When approved or rejected, a notification is sent immediately with the status and any rejection details.
